Wnsoft has released PicturesToExe 6.0 with some innovative new features including:

What's new in version 6.0:

3D Effects for Images and Text
A fresh impression to your slideshow by rotating of images, text and other objects in 3D is added.

Output for Mac
While using PicturesToExe Deluxe 6.0 for Windows you can create slideshows for Mac in the native executable files with the highest picture quality and smoothness of animation effects.

Multidisplay support
If you connect two displays and click Preview button the program will ask you for the desired monitor for the fullscreen preview of your slideshow.

Vectorization of Text Objects
A better visual quality of text objects. You can use any unique fonts for your slideshow now. PicturesToExe will automatically vectorize text objects and text comments and show text with the highest quality at any display resolution.

New Customizable Startup and Help windows
New, fully customizable Startup window and Help window. You can also create your own dialog windows using Objects and animation editor.

Border for Images
Add color border to an Image object and set canvas size for it.

Editor of Masks
A built-in editor to create masks directly in PicturesToExe for special effects is added.
